Gmail
This describes the SASL XOAUTH2 Mechanism
used by gmail to access to mailbox.
Authenticate with Oauth 2.0
Then use the Bearer to initialize SMTP/IMAP operations
The url for the request credentials popup
https://accounts.google.com/o/oauth2/v2/auth?
scope=https://mail.google.com/&
access_type=offline&
include_granted_scopes=true&
state=state_parameter_passthrough_value&
redirect_uri=<caliopen instance/api/v2/oauth/google/callback>
response_type=code&
client_id=<client_id>
How to configure the gmail protocol
- Go to https://console.developers.google.com/
- Create a new project (choose a name for the project)
- go to "credentials" page
- click on "create credentials"
- select "OAuth client ID"
- choose application type: "Web application"
- name it as you want (for example: "oauth
caliopen instance") - FIXME in the field "Authorized redirect URIs" enter the url for this api:
https://<caliopen instance/api/v2/oauth/google/callback>
then press "Enter" - Click "Create"
- on credentials page, copy the client_id of the credential you have created
- FIXME and add it to the config
